An equiconvex lens is cut two halves along (i) XOX' and (ii) YOY' as shown in the figure. Let f, f^ , f^ be the focal length of the complete lens, of each half in case (i) and each half in case (ii), respectively. Choose the correct statement from the following:
Options
- Af^ =f, f^ =2 f
- Bf^ =2 f, f^ =f
- Cf^ =f, f^ =f
- Df=2 f, f^ =2 f
Correct answer
A. f^ =f, f^ =2 f
Step-by-step solution
Since the lens is equiconvex, the radius of curvature of each half is same.
